Output 75fd804a310e9d882dd199b038a719d0eabf026b8a0d49f29caa39e985da85de:2

value
852699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fd14a12a10d3374252c5866c21e31a84b2c956 OP_EQUAL
address
2MwFpDszKBtdm3YFL3fKeYNN9ojbeveuZjf
transaction
75fd804a310e9d882dd199b038a719d0eabf026b8a0d49f29caa39e985da85de
confirmations
105058
spent
true